The child has been living with her South African mother at a Mauritius prison for the past five years since her birth.

does not act quickly to repatriate a 5-year-old child born to a South African mother imprisoned in Mauritius, it could make it harder for her to ever return to her family in the future.that a team will travel to Mauritius to bring the little girl back to South Africa. They will leave on 9 December 2024 and are expected to return on 13 December 2024.

SA’s Department of Social Development explained that if the little girl is not brought back to South Africa, she might be placed in the welfare system in Mauritius. This could make it much harder for her to be reunited with her family in South Africa in the future. This operation will give the 5-year-old girl the chance to grow up in a stable home with her family. The department said it is working to ensure her best interests are protected.Women prisons in Mauritius are not designed to accommodate mothers with children and often lack the safe, nurturing environments essential for a child’s healthy development.
